FTP account as network location in windows
Hello
in my Cpanel, I added new FTP with the name "genius" and it's details as following
FTP Username: genius@mydomain.com
FTP server: ftp.mydomain.com
FTP & explicit FTPS port: 21
now if I want to add it in windows as network location it wont work as the username contains "@" in the username
it give me error
[QUOTE]---------------------------
FTP Folder Error
---------------------------
Windows cannot access this folder. Make sure you typed the file name correctly and that you have permission to access the folder.
Details:
The URL is invalid
because the path is "ftp://genius@mydomain.com%40ftp.mydomain.com/" how to solve this problem ?

after many trials, I logged in successfuly I added the ftp just like usual but in the username input I changed the "@" sign with " %40" and it worked. 0 -
